Description
German, mid to late 18th century, stoneware bottle with sprig applied lion and rosette decoration, 9-1/2 in.; pinch spouted pitcher with incised foliate decoration, 11-3/4 in.Literature: Igor Noel Hume, If These Pots Could Talk: Collecting 2,000 Years of British Household Pottery, Hanover and London: Chipstone Foundation and New England Press, 2001, page 92, ill. (bottle only)Provenance: The I. Noel Hume Collection of Artifacts and Antiquities
Condition
bottle with hairline cracks throughout spout, neck and handle, chip/loss to left of handle, cracks in right lion, sticky residue on body, pitcher with chip on rim, sticky residue interior rim, minor chips and abrasions throughout
